Project Title

ShopVersia

Project Area of Specialization Augmented and Virtual RealityProject Summary

The proposed Virtual Reality Application will have an interactive and understandable user interface. A guide will be provided to the user for its very first use. The proposed system can be used by the help of a Virtual Reality Glasses and Controllers. User have to configure its VR device first and then proceeds towards the VR shopping. A guide list of VR devices and their configuration will be provided. After successful VR device check the user will be able to enter into the Virtual reality environment and will allow to purchase products. The delivery of the products will depend on the time specified by the user. The minimum delivery time will be 4 hours depending on user premises.

We will be assuming that the user is pre matured and have some idea for using Virtual Reality glasses and controllers. The system will let user to enter its user name and password to login and to sign up for new users. User will have freedom to walk in virtual world and to grab the products with the help of controllers and place it in cart. Few 3D models will also be implemented and for other things we will use unity assets. By using scripting languages we will manage the user accounts, products and carts.

The products that are bought by users must have a complete detail and acquires user satisfaction. The user satisfaction can be highly achieved in a case if user physically check the product its space, length, width, height etc. and can view it from every perspective.

Project Objectives

The objective of the proposed project is to build a Virtual Reality Based Application for a shopping system. The application will let the user to purchase things in a computer generated shopping center, which will allow user to experience the real essence of shopping. With the help of a virtual reality based device and controllers, the user will be able to move in the shopping center, to pick a product which can be added into a cart and enjoy the shopping from home but in real environment. The user will be able to see the details of selected product in a dialogue box like ingredients, qualities, price etc., and the system will help user to select the product.

The user will have freedom to unselect the products and proceed to final checkout. The user will be asked for the preferred delivery time so the product will be delivered accordingly to the user and different methods of payment will be available for user. The proposed system is B2C (business to consumer).

Project Implementation Method

The development of virtual reality environment is a difficult and complex task. Small Environment does not need much attention but our system will be large and complex system. Complex project will require starting phases of the software development like planning, analysis etc. As we are planning to create virtual world with interactive objects so we needed a methodology that can support our virtual reality objects consisting of scenario driven virtual environment. The software methodology used for a given project will be Agile.

Each Milestone is allocated time that is sprint which have to be completed in the specified time. Each milestone will be planned, implement, test and review through out the end of the project.

Technical Details of Final Deliverable

The Final Deliverable include a Virtual Reality shopping Application alomg with the Oculus Rift having the following Features

  1. Move freely in the store to explore and find product.
  2. Products can be seen through naked eye.
  3. You can pick products and can watch it from every perspective that includes its size, color, details which will be same as in physical world.
  4. You can pick the product and can move it from one place to another.
  5. You can add product into the cart.
  6. You can change the product quantity in the cart.
  7. There will be a checkout option which will confirm your address and preffered delivery time.
  8. A dialog box will appear when user clicks on the product through controller.
  9. The dialog box include the detail of the product like its brands, price, ingridients and other details etc.
  10. The Add to cart option will also be in that dialog box.
  11. Total Amount will also be shown in a dialog box.
  12. There will be a counter in the shopping store where following icons will be placed 
    1. Login/Signup
    2. Cart
    3. Checkout
  13. User must be logged in to proceed to checkout.
  14. In signup following details will be taken from user
    1. Name
    2. Email Address
    3. Delivery Address
    4. Contact No
    5. Password
    6. Confirm Password
  15. You can go the cart by going to the counter by clicking on the cart icon through the controller.
  16. You can also go to the checkout option by clicking on the checkout icon theough the controller.
